Mission Bay Montessori Academy is located in the University City section of San Diego on 18 acres, in a secluded setting, bounded by canyon and park.
Our purpose is to aid the development of the child to the fullest possible realization of the child's unique individual potentialities.
The Montessori Method is based on a child's imperious need to learn by doing.
It develops the whole personality of the child, not merely their intellectual faculties, but also their powers of deliberation, initiative and independent choice with their emotional complements.
The mission of Maria Montessori School is to provide a complete Montessori program which considers the emotional, intellectual, physical, and social development of the total child by addressing the uniqueness of each in a nurturing, emotionally secure and academically excellent environment.
